As the 2010s come to a close, we have won 2 premierships, 6 finals series, including a minor premiership. No doubt any team of the decade would be heavily stacked with premiership players. Can we find room for anyone else?

Backs: Grimes, Rance, Vlastuin
HB: Houli, Astbury, Newman
C: Grigg, Martin, Deledio
HF: Lambert, Lynch, Caddy
F: King, Riewoldt, Edwards
R: Maric, Cotchin, Prestia
IC: Foley, Castagna, Nankervis, Rioli
E: Broad, Jackson, Bellis

Thoughts?

Foley‘s best work was over 10 years ago though, since then he’s only had 1 top 10 finish in the B&F (8th in 2011).

Still managed 21.6 disposals in 2011 and 23.3 in 2012 and averaged 5.6 tackles a game and received 9 Brownlow votes. And his disposals were always immaculate despite getting alot of contested ball (over 72% 2011 to 2014) . Started tapering off in his last 2 years after that but imo that puts him well ahead of a few others.
